The Greek Football Federation has handed a two-year contract extension to national team coach Fernando Santos which runs through the 2014 World Cup.

The previous deal for the 57-year-old Santos ran through Euro 2012, but the new contract will see the Portuguese manager guide Greece through the 2014 World Cup in Brazil.

Santos took over for Otto Rehhagel following the 2010 World Cup and has the club on a 16-game unbeaten streak.

Greece qualified for Euro 2012 by finishing on top of its group and was drawn into Group A for this summer's competition along with Poland, Russia and the Czech Republic.
